发表评论取消回复
相关阅读
相关 深入理解JVM虚拟机第三十篇:详解JVM当中栈帧的一些附加信息以及虚拟机栈的5个面试题
这个得具体问题具体分析。//线程安全的//线程不安全的。//把变量丢出去,有可能不安全。return s;}).start();method2(s);method1();
相关 函数栈帧(栈区)
函数栈帧(栈区) 一.前言 二.main函数空间的开辟(函数调用是如何做到的) 三.main函数内部的变量初始化(局部变量是如何创建的以及为什么是随机值
相关 [c语言] 返回栈空间地址 问题
当我们返回栈空间地址时会报错,为什么呢?那让我们先看一下什么是返回栈空间地址? 下面是错误示范: vs2022版演示 ![70a343f019d84adc96bc3e75
相关 深入理解jvm-栈帧&方法调用
> 本文为读书笔记 文章目录 1. 基本概念 springboot源码里有一个部分: 2. 局部变量表 3. 操作数栈 4. 动态连
相关 函数入栈出栈以及栈帧
参考一 函数调用是程序设计中的重要环节,也是程序员应聘时常被问及的,本文就函数调用的过程进行分析。 一、堆和栈 首先要清楚的是程序对内存的使
相关 栈帧
http://blog.csdn.net/yxysdcl/article/details/5569351 首先应该明白,栈是从高地址向低地址延伸的。每个函数的每次调用,
相关 栈溢出之覆盖函数返回地址
栈溢出之覆盖函数返回地址 原理 利用 原理 > 栈溢出:栈溢出就是栈上的缓冲区填入过多的数据,超出了边界,从而导致了栈上原有数据被覆盖。 函数调用的
相关 方法返回地址以及栈帧中的附加信息
一 方法返回地址 1 点睛 存放调用该方法的 pc 寄存器的值。 一个方法的结束,有两种方式。 正常执行完成。 出现未处理的异常,非正常退出。 无
还没有评论,来说两句吧...